    In the US, the demand for math and science professionals is on the rise, with many industries seeking individuals with expertise in these areas. As a result, educators and institutions are placing greater emphasis on teaching mathematical concepts, including LCM. Moreover, the increasing use of technology and automation has created a need for people who can effectively apply mathematical principles to real-world problems. The ability to find the LCM of two numbers, like 9 and 8, is a fundamental skill that can benefit various fields, from finance to engineering.

  • The concept of finding the lowest common multiple (LCM) has been around for centuries, but its significance has been increasingly recognized in the US, particularly in the fields of mathematics and engineering. The recent surge in interest can be attributed to its practical applications in real-world problems, such as scheduling, resource allocation, and project management. As a result, understanding how to find the LCM of two numbers, like 9 and 8, has become a valuable skill for professionals and enthusiasts alike.
